Chemical variation in leaf oils of Pistacia chinensis from five locations in China
Authors:Bin Zhu  Qingbiao Wang  Esben F Roge  Peng Nan  Zhijun Liu  Yang Zhong
Institution:(1) Ministry of Education Key Laboratory for Biodiversity Science and Ecological Engineering, School of Life Sciences, Fudan University, Shanghai, 200433, China;(2) Department of Biochemistry, University of Aarhus, Nordre Ringgade 1, DK-8000 Aarhus C, Denmark;(3) School of Renewable Natural Resources, Louisiana State University Agricultural Center, Baton Rouge, LA 70803, USA
Abstract:Hydrodistilled leaf oils of Pistacia chinensis Bunge from five locations in China were analyzed using GC/MS. A total of 58 compounds was identified in the oils, and a relatively high variation in their contents was found. The major compounds include β-phellandrene (0.54–53.86%), α-pinene (4.74–54.44%), β-pinene (0.49–42.90%), caryophyllene (5.64–20.01%), cis-ocimene (tr−43.93%), eudesmadiene (0–15.06%), and camphene (tr−20.57%). Cluster analysis classified the leaf oils into two chemotypes: one rich in α-pinene and β-pinene, and the other rich in β-phellandrene.
